Understanding the Lifespan of Solar Panels

Solar panels, typically designed to last for several decades, are the cornerstone of your solar energy system. Understanding their lifespan and what influences it can help you make more informed decisions when investing in solar energy.

The Expected Lifespan of Solar Panels

The lifespan of commercial solar panels generally spans 25–30 years. Industry studies indicate a degradation rate of about 0.5% per year, meaning even after 25 years, a solar panel could still produce 80–90% of its original output (source). Modern solar panels made from materials like monocrystalline silicon are particularly durable, often exceeding this benchmark.

Factors Affecting the Lifespan of Solar Panels

Several key factors contribute to solar panels' durability and efficiency:

  • Material Quality: Panels made with high-grade materials, like monocrystalline silicon, offer better efficiency and longevity compared to polycrystalline panels.
  • Environmental Conditions: Panels exposed to extreme temperatures, hail, or UV radiation may degrade faster than those in milder climates.
  • Installation Quality: Professionally installed panels last longer, as they are less prone to misalignment or physical damage.

Lifespan of Inverters: Why They Matter

Inverters convert the direct current (DC) electricity generated by solar panels into alternating current (AC) electricity for business use. Although inverters typically have a shorter lifespan than panels, they are just as crucial to your system's performance.

The Expected Lifespan of Inverters

On average, inverters last 10–15 years, depending on their type and use. Technological advancements, like microinverters and string inverters, now offer improved reliability and longer lifespans. According to a report by the Solar Energy Industries Association (SEIA), properly maintained inverters can extend efficiency while minimizing downtime.

Factors Affecting the Lifespan of Inverters

  • Type of Inverter: String inverters, commonly used in commercial systems, tend to last longer than older models. Microinverters, though smaller, often boast extended durability in certain applications.
  • Maintenance and Monitoring: Regular checks and updates ensure optimal performance, reducing wear and tear over time.
  • Climate Conditions: High humidity or excessive heat can accelerate degradation. Systems in temperate climates generally fare better.
